Crafting a captivating online presence is paramount in today’s digital landscape, and WordPress stands as a powerful platform for achieving this. More than just a blogging tool, it’s a versatile content management system (CMS) that empowers businesses and individuals to create stunning, functional websites. But simply installing WordPress isn’t enough; effective WordPress design is the key to attracting and engaging your target audience. This post delves into the essential aspects of WordPress design, providing you with the knowledge to build a website that not only looks great but also drives results.
Understanding the Fundamentals of WordPress Design
What is WordPress Design?
WordPress design encompasses everything that contributes to the visual appeal and user experience of your website. It goes beyond just aesthetics and includes considerations like:
- Visual Layout: The arrangement of elements on your pages, including headers, footers, sidebars, and content areas.
- Typography: The choice of fonts, sizes, and styles used to display text.
- Color Palette: The selection of colors that create a cohesive and visually appealing brand identity.
- Imagery: The use of photos, illustrations, and videos to enhance content and convey your message.
- Usability: Ensuring the site is easy to navigate and use on all devices.
Ultimately, effective WordPress design blends aesthetics with functionality to create a positive user experience that aligns with your business goals.
The Difference Between Themes and Page Builders
Understanding the difference between WordPress themes and page builders is crucial for planning your website’s design.
- Themes: Provide the overall structure and style of your website. They control the layout, typography, and basic design elements. Think of them as the framework for your house. Free and premium themes are available.
- Page Builders: Allow you to create custom layouts and design individual pages using drag-and-drop interfaces. Think of them as the interior design tools for your house. Popular page builders include Elementor, Beaver Builder, and Divi.
While themes offer a foundation, page builders provide the flexibility to customize your site to your exact specifications. Many themes are now built to integrate seamlessly with popular page builders, giving you the best of both worlds.
- Example: You might choose a minimalist theme for its clean layout and then use Elementor to create a visually engaging homepage with custom sections, animations, and calls-to-action.
Selecting the Right WordPress Theme
Free vs. Premium Themes: Which is Right for You?
Choosing between a free and premium WordPress theme depends on your budget, technical skills, and desired level of customization.
- Free Themes:
Pros: Cost-effective, readily available in the WordPress repository.
Cons: Limited features, basic design options, potentially less support, may not be regularly updated.
- Premium Themes:
Pros: More features, advanced design options, dedicated support, regular updates, often more secure.
Cons: Cost money, can be overwhelming with too many features.
- Actionable Takeaway: If you’re on a tight budget or need a simple website, a free theme might suffice. However, for businesses that require a professional, feature-rich website with reliable support, a premium theme is generally the better investment.
Key Features to Look for in a Theme
When selecting a WordPress theme, consider these important features:
- Responsiveness: Ensures your website looks good on all devices (desktops, tablets, and smartphones).
- Customization Options: Look for a theme with ample customization options, allowing you to change colors, fonts, layouts, and other design elements without coding.
- SEO Friendliness: A well-coded theme optimized for search engines can improve your website’s visibility in search results.
- Speed Optimization: A fast-loading theme enhances user experience and improves search engine rankings.
- Plugin Compatibility: Ensure the theme is compatible with popular WordPress plugins you plan to use.
- Support and Documentation: Choose a theme from a reputable developer that offers reliable support and comprehensive documentation.
- Example: Before purchasing a premium theme, read reviews, check the developer’s website for documentation, and test the theme’s demo to ensure it meets your requirements.
Mastering WordPress Page Builders
Why Use a Page Builder?
WordPress page builders simplify the process of creating custom page layouts without requiring coding knowledge. They offer several advantages:
- Drag-and-Drop Interface: Create visually appealing pages by dragging and dropping elements into place.
- Pre-built Templates: Save time by using pre-designed templates for various types of pages (e.g., landing pages, about us pages, contact pages).
- Real-time Editing: See your changes instantly as you make them.
- Customization Options: Control every aspect of your page design, from colors and fonts to spacing and animations.
- Responsive Design: Ensure your pages look great on all devices.
- Statistic: According to recent surveys, over 60% of WordPress users utilize page builders to create their websites.
Popular WordPress Page Builders
Several excellent page builders are available for WordPress. Some of the most popular options include:
- Elementor: A user-friendly page builder with a wide range of features and a large community.
- Beaver Builder: A flexible and powerful page builder known for its stability and clean code.
- Divi: A visual page builder with a unique interface and a vast library of pre-designed layouts.
- WPBakery Page Builder (formerly Visual Composer): One of the oldest and most widely used page builders, offering a comprehensive set of features.
- Actionable Takeaway: Try out the free versions of several page builders to see which one best suits your needs and skill level before investing in a premium license.
Optimizing Your WordPress Design for User Experience (UX)
The Importance of UX in WordPress Design
User experience (UX) refers to how users interact with and feel about your website. A positive UX is essential for:
- Attracting and retaining visitors.
- Improving conversion rates.
- Boosting search engine rankings.
- Building brand loyalty.
A well-designed website that provides a seamless and enjoyable experience is more likely to achieve its goals.
Key UX Principles to Implement
- Clear Navigation: Make it easy for users to find what they’re looking for. Use a clear and consistent menu structure.
- Fast Loading Speed: Optimize your website for speed. Use a caching plugin, compress images, and choose a fast hosting provider. According to Google, 53% of mobile users abandon a site if it takes longer than 3 seconds to load.
- Mobile-First Design: Design your website with mobile users in mind. Ensure it is responsive and easy to use on small screens.
- Easy-to-Read Content: Use clear fonts, sufficient white space, and short paragraphs to make your content easy to read.
- Clear Calls-to-Action: Use clear and compelling calls-to-action to guide users towards desired actions (e.g., “Contact Us,” “Learn More,” “Buy Now”).
- Accessibility: Make your website accessible to users with disabilities. Use alt text for images, provide keyboard navigation, and ensure sufficient color contrast.
- Example: Regularly test your website’s usability by asking friends or colleagues to perform specific tasks and observe their behavior. Use website analytics to identify areas where users are dropping off or encountering difficulties.
Enhancing WordPress Design with Plugins
Essential Design Plugins
WordPress plugins can extend the functionality of your website and enhance its design capabilities. Here are some essential design plugins:
- Image Optimization Plugins (e.g., Smush, Imagify): Compress images to reduce file sizes and improve website speed.
- Caching Plugins (e.g., WP Rocket, W3 Total Cache): Cache your website to improve loading times.
- Contact Form Plugins (e.g., Contact Form 7, WPForms): Create contact forms for your website.
- Social Media Plugins (e.g., Social Warfare, Shared Counts): Integrate social media sharing buttons into your website.
- Security Plugins (e.g., Wordfence, Sucuri Security): Protect your website from malware and other security threats.
- SEO Plugins (e.g., Yoast SEO, Rank Math): Optimize your website for search engines.
Tips for Choosing Plugins
- Read Reviews: Check user reviews before installing a plugin.
- Check Compatibility: Ensure the plugin is compatible with your version of WordPress and your theme.
- Look for Regular Updates: Choose plugins that are regularly updated by the developer.
- Avoid Overloading: Don’t install too many plugins, as they can slow down your website.
- Consider Premium Options: For advanced features and dedicated support, consider premium plugins.
- Actionable Takeaway:* Before installing any plugin, back up your website to avoid data loss in case of compatibility issues.
Conclusion
WordPress design is a multifaceted process that involves careful planning, thoughtful execution, and ongoing optimization. By understanding the fundamentals of WordPress design, selecting the right theme, mastering page builders, prioritizing user experience, and leveraging the power of plugins, you can create a website that not only looks great but also achieves your business goals. Remember to stay updated with the latest design trends and technologies to ensure your website remains competitive and engaging. With the right approach, WordPress can be a powerful tool for building a successful online presence.